CodeFactor.io features and specs

  • Real-time Code Review
    CodeFactor.io provides immediate feedback on code changes by performing real-time code reviews, which helps catch issues early in the development process.
  • Integration with Popular Platforms
    The platform offers seamless integration with popular version control systems like GitHub, GitLab, and Bitbucket, allowing easy adoption into existing workflows.
  • Detailed Reports
    Generates detailed reports with clear metrics and actionable insights on code quality, helping teams understand and improve their codebase.
  • Automated Code Review
    Automates the code review process, saving developers time and ensuring consistency in code quality assessments.
  • Support for Multiple Languages
    Supports a wide range of programming languages, making it versatile for teams working with diverse technology stacks.

Possible disadvantages of CodeFactor.io

  • Limited Free Plan
    The free plan has limitations in terms of features and the number of private repositories it can support, which may not be sufficient for larger teams or projects.
  • False Positives/Negatives
    Like many automated code review tools, CodeFactor.io can sometimes generate false positives or negatives, which might require manual inspection.
  • Performance Issues
    Some users have reported performance issues, such as slow analysis times, especially with very large codebases.
  • Learning Curve
    Although the interface is user-friendly, there can be a learning curve associated with interpreting some of the more detailed metrics and reports.
  • Customization Limitations
    The level of customization in the analysis rules and settings can be limited compared to some other code quality tools, potentially restricting its adaptability to specific team needs.

Monstroid2 features and specs

  • Versatility
    Monstroid2 is a multi-purpose WordPress theme that can be used for various types of websites, from personal blogs to corporate portals and online stores. Its versatility allows users to create different kinds of sites without needing additional themes.
  • Wide Range of Templates
    The theme includes over 20 pre-designed website templates, providing a significant head start for building a polished website. These templates cover a broad spectrum of industries and purposes.
  • Elementor Page Builder Compatibility
    Monstroid2 is compatible with the Elementor Page Builder, a popular drag-and-drop page builder, which makes it easy to customize page layouts without any coding knowledge.
  • Regular Updates
    The theme is regularly updated to ensure compatibility with the latest WordPress versions and to improve security, ensuring a stable and secure website environment.
  • Comprehensive Documentation and Support
    Monstroid2 comes with detailed documentation and access to 24/7 customer support, enabling users to resolve issues and learn how to maximize the theme's potential.

Possible disadvantages of Monstroid2

  • Learning Curve
    Given its multitude of features and customization options, new users might find Monstroid2 overwhelming, requiring time to learn and utilize all its functionalities effectively.
  • Potential for Bloat
    Due to its extensive features and bundled plugins, there is a risk of performance slowdowns, which could occur if unnecessary components are not managed properly.
  • Price
    Monstroid2 is a premium theme that might be considered expensive for small businesses or freelancers operating on tight budgets, especially when compared to other themes with similar capabilities.
  • Dependence on Elementor
    While Elementor is a powerful tool, the theme's heavy reliance on it might be a downside for users who prefer other page builders or who want to avoid the constraints of a third-party tool.
